Denarius of Lucius Caesius, 112-111 BC. On the obverse is Apollo, who also wears the attributes of Vejovis. Behind is head ROMA as a monogram. The obverse depicts a group of statues representing the Lares Praestites, which was described by Ovid. Source Wikipedia Article on Caesia Gens
